当前位置: 首页 > news >正文

黄骅港一期煤码头潮汐表百度seo排名如何提升

黄骅港一期煤码头潮汐表,百度seo排名如何提升,十种人不适合学建筑,wordpress 仿站背景 在使用Git推送代码的时候,会默认需要输入密码。如果经常推送代码,那就需要经常输入密码,比较繁琐。所以Git也提供了免密登录的功能。 Git本身支持两种协议对远程Git仓库进行访问:HTTPS、SSH。两种方式有一定的区别&#xf…

背景

在使用Git推送代码的时候,会默认需要输入密码。如果经常推送代码,那就需要经常输入密码,比较繁琐。所以Git也提供了免密登录的功能。

Git本身支持两种协议对远程Git仓库进行访问:HTTPS、SSH。两种方式有一定的区别,不过区别不是本博客的重点,就不过多介绍。本文重点介绍通过SSH协议对远程仓库进行访问时,如何配置免密登录

配置免密

生成RSA密钥

打开cmd命令行,输入如下命令生成密钥:

ssh-keygen -t rsa -C "xxx"  # -C后面的内容是注释,可以随便填写

第一使用该命令时,之后会在用户目录下生成.ssh文件夹。其中会有一些文件,包括:id_rsaid_rsa.pub以及其他的文件。id_rsa是私钥,id_rsa.pub是公钥。

将公钥内容上传到Git服务器

将公钥文件中的内容复制,并保存到服务器的~/.ssh/authorized_keys文件中。

配置ssh

现在密钥有了,还需要在本机配置什么时候,用密钥进行免密登录。这里要用到~/.ssh文件夹中的config文件。需要注意,这个文件不是生成的,需要手动创建。创建好后,填写如下信息:

Host 服务器别名HostName 服务器主机名(IP)User 登录用户名IdentityFile ~/.ssh/id_rsa

其中

  • Host服务器别名是指,在使用ssh协议进行通讯的时候,不需要写完整的IP,只需要写别名就可以,比较方便
  • HostName就是服务器实际的IP
  • User是登录的用户名
  • IdentityFile是RSA私钥的路径

这里记录一个我遇到的坑。我之前在SSH的config文件中配置了一次服务器的相关信息。但是之后这个服务器突然搬到另外一个地方去了,IP变了,端口也变了。我之后再使用Git进行推送的时候,因为太久没配置ssh了,忘记了有config这个文件,以为把Git的IP改了就行了。结果死活推送不上去。之后才发现要改SSH的config文件吗,把端口去掉才行。

另外,SSH密钥是全局的,并不局限于在Git中使用。只要计算机通讯用到了SSH协议,都可以使用这个密钥进行免密登录,比如:

  • SSH命令,远程登录到另外一台机器
  • SCP命令,在本机和远程机器之间传输文件
  • Git相关的命令,比如git clone、git push等
http://www.ds6.com.cn/news/56063.html

相关文章:

  • 漳州网站建设公司推荐网络服务中心
  • 网站建设的缺陷网站排名优化外包公司
  • cms 网站后台内容管理系统模板互联网项目推广
  • 宁波网站定制服务个人如何建立免费网站
  • 网站怎么关键字优化阿里云搜索引擎入口
  • 免费w网站建设windows永久禁止更新
  • 网站建设实训该写哪些内容百度指数查询工具app
  • 订阅号 小程序福州seo网站推广优化
  • 网站建设合同 附件厦门网站推广优化哪家好
  • 日本做a的动画电影网站免费发布推广的平台有哪些
  • 基层政府网站建设论文摘要产品营销策略有哪些
  • 网站建设相关视频安卓优化大师历史版本
  • 万网建网站教程百度热线电话
  • 秦皇岛建设局网站十大最靠谱教育培训机构
  • 个人做跨境电商的平台网站有哪些新的网络推广方式
  • 123seo排名系统源码
  • app公司是怎么赚钱的seo扣费系统源码
  • 网站的建设与运营模式职业培训机构资质
  • wordpress新建网站小程序开发
  • 做网站gzip压缩第三方关键词优化排名
  • 一般的域名可以做彩票网站吗培训班招生方案
  • 新手学做网站 下载网站建设开发公司
  • 福山区建设工程质量检测站网站app推广注册放单平台
  • 建设街小学网站成都seo推广
  • 网站banner自动隐藏南京百度推广优化排名
  • 兰州做网站怎么样如何对网站进行推广
  • wordpress主题商城主题西安网站关键词优化推荐
  • 直接登录的网站百度浏览器打开
  • 学做花蛤的网站今日军事新闻
  • 湖北发布最新疫情seo新站如何快速排名